If they are connected between different nodes, they are not in parallel, even if they look like they’re in parallel and have the same numerical voltage across them. emphasize that the voltage across each parallel resistor is the same, whereas the current may differ; the total current, i t entering a parallel resistive circuit is the sum of all the individual currents flowing in all the parallel branches. current in parallel circuits. in a parallel circuit, charge divides up into separate branches such that there can be more current in one branch than there is in another. resistors in parallel have the same numerical voltage drop because they are connected between the same two nodes.
